Frequently Requested Questions Regarding Black Wedding Designers

1. Who are some prominent Black wedding designers?

Some prominent Black wedding designers include:
1. Amsale Aberra: Amsale Aberra was an Ethiopian-American designer who revolutionized the bridal industry with her minimalist and modern designs.
2. Tracy Reese: Tracy Reese is a well-known African-American fashion designer who has also ventured into the bridal industry, bringing her unique sense of style and diversity to wedding dresses.
3. Kevan Hall: Kevan Hall is an African-American designer known for his elegant and sophisticated bridal gowns that truly embody classic beauty.

5. Are there any organizations or platforms that promote Black wedding designers?

Yes, there are organizations and platforms that specifically promote Black wedding designers, such as:
1. Black bride: Black Bride is an online platform dedicated to showcasing and promoting Black wedding vendors, including designers. They provide a directory and various resources for couples planning their weddings.
2. The Black Wedding Collective: The Black Wedding Collective is an organization that seeks to educate, uplift, and support Black wedding vendors, including designers. They offer a community platform and resources to help couples and professionals connect.
3. Bridal Inspiration: Bridal Inspiration is a digital publication that focuses on showcasing diverse wedding styles and vendors. They actively promote and feature Black wedding designers along with other talented designers from various backgrounds.
